Department of Communications and Connectivity Infrastructure A. Principles of Secure Communications Infrastructure Modern civilization’s nervous system is its communications infrastructure, spanning local fiber-optic grids, global submarine cables, and extra-planetary links. Safeguarding these arteries against state and non-state threat actors has become existentially critical to governance, commerce, and defense. 1. Hardening and Visibility (Telecom, Coastal, & Interchange Systems) • Visibility involves deep, real-time insight into network traffic, device configuration, and user behavior, indispensable for threat detection and rapid incident response. • Hardening means configuring routers, switches, and firewalls for minimum attack surfaces: enforcing strict Access Control Lists (ACLs), segmenting networks, and minimizing externally accessible services. • Place management interfaces on out-of-band physically separate networks, with centralized, off-device store and push of configurations. • Logging and auditing at OS and application levels, with robust SIEM (Security Information and Event Management) solutions, is essential. Logs should always be encrypted and stored off-site. • Regular patching, vulnerability scanning, and segmentation are vital to prevent lateral movement—even more so in coastal and interchange systems, which are exposed at both national and intercontinental boundaries. • Deploy source-of-truth cryptographic verification for device and firmware images. Table 1: Best Practices for Communications Infrastructure Hardening Practice Description Guidance Level Device Segregation Physical/logical separation of management/admin Mandatory Secure Logging Corelated, off-site, encrypted event logs Mandatory ACL Enforcement Default-deny, log-deny, granular VLAN segmentation Mandatory Multi-Factor Auth (MFA) Phishing-resistant, for all privileged accesses Very Strongly Advised Remove Default Credentials Change all defaults, use complex hashing schemes Mandatory Patch Management Immediate updates, anticipate EOL announcements Mandatory Strong Cryptography Only TLS v1.3, AES-256, SHA-384/512 or higher Very Strongly Advised These layers act as defense-in-depth, each compensating for failures above or below it. This is the backbone on which all civilizational communications, terrestrial and extra-terrestrial, depend. 2. Department of Biological, Intercellular, and Ecological Communications A. Intercellular Communication and Biosignaling 1. Core Pathways: GPCR, RTK, and JAK-STAT Life is organized by an ancient logic of message exchange: biochemical pathways transfer and amplify signals, orchestrating development, homeostasis, and adaptation. • G-Protein Coupled Receptors (GPCRs): Ubiquitous cell-surface sensors triggering cascades for hormonal, olfactory, and photonic cues. • Receptor Tyrosine Kinases (RTKs): Enzyme-coupled receptors regulating cell growth and survival. • JAK-STAT Pathway: Core in immune signaling, inflammation, and programmed death (apoptosis). Cell signaling in tissues encompasses contact-dependent (juxtacrine), paracrine, autocrine, synaptic, and endocrine methods, mirroring protocol layering in digital networks. 2. Intercellular Protocol Topology Like Internet routers, biological cells maintain selective address books: each has characteristic arrays of receptors and can process multiple overlapping signals—creating a cross-matrix architecture deeply resilient to single-point failure. 3. Ecological Communication: Quorum Sensing and Beyond Bacteria coordinate via quorum sensing—producing and detecting messenger molecules to synchronize activities such as bioluminescence and biofilm formation. This is the microbial precursor to public-key broadcast: an emergent consensus mechanism governing population-wide behaviors and resistance responses. --- B. Biometric and Biosensory Blueprints 1. Human and Ecological Biosensors State-of-the-art biosensors—printed, flexible, and miniaturized—now allow non-invasive, real-time tracking of vital parameters: • Heart rate (ECG/HRV) sensors for healthcare and athlete monitoring. • Respiratory, activity, temperature, and muscle electrical activity monitoring—embedded in smart clothing, patches, and even direct-on-skin printed circuits. • Environmental biosensors for detecting pathogens, toxins, or pollutants in aquatic and terrestrial domains—mirroring decentralized mesh monitoring nodes. Family Table: Core Biological Sensor Applications Sensor Type Bio/Medical Application Ecological Parallel Cardiac (ECG/HRV) Arrhythmia, stress detection Population heartbeat (quorum) Respiratory COPD/asthma monitoring Gas exchange in plant/coral reefs EMG/Muscle Rehabilitation, training Strain in plant tissues Chemical (Glucose/O2) Diabetes, hypoxia Nutrient/oxidant cycles in water Flexible, printed, and smart textile biosensors are now scaled for deployment in healthcare, athletic performance, and occupational safety. Their real-time outputs can be federated, analyzed, and fed across both personal and institutional connectivity systems. 2. Bluetooth Athletic and Wearable Systems Bluetooth-enabled biosensor networks form personal body area networks (BANs), where physiological and biomechanical data is relayed to smartphones or local AI for real-time feedback, telemedicine, and performance enhancement. --- C. Biochemical Catalysts and Pathways 1. Enzymes and Microbial Catalysis At the heart of biochemical transactions, enzymes act as biological catalysts—hydrolases, oxidoreductases, transferases, isomerases, lyases, and ligases—carrying out transformations with high selectivity, speed, and under mild conditions. • Industrial Applications: Enzymes are used in pharmaceuticals, food processing, detergents, biofuels, and environmental remediation. • Microbial platforms such as E. coli, Bacillus, Aspergillus, and Pichia enable scalable bio-production. • Engineering approaches—directed evolution, rational design, machine learning-guided mutagenesis—continually improve activity, substrate scope, and resilience. Table 3: Key Classes and Applications of Catalysts Enzyme Class Example Role Industrial Application Hydrolases Break bonds via hydrolysis Detergents, textiles, food Oxidoreductases Redox catalysis Waste treatment, dye decolor Transferases Move functional groups Drug synthesis, food Lyases Add/remove atoms to double bonds Fine chemicals, flavorings Isomerases Rearrange molecular structure Sweetener production Ligases Join large molecules DNA assembly, biotechnology Bacteria as living catalysts can transform, detoxify, and synthesize an enormous variety of molecules—including pharmaceuticals, polymers, and fuels—through regulated metabolic pathways. --- III.
